site stats

Convert torchscript to onnx

WebJun 10, 2024 · To convert a seq2seq model (encoder-decoder) you have to split them and convert them separately, an encoder to onnx and a decoder to onnx. you can follow this guide (it was done for T5 which is also a seq2seq model). you need to provide a dummy variable to both encoder and to the decoder separately. by default when converting … WebApr 10, 2024 · 转换步骤. pytorch转为onnx的代码网上很多,也比较简单,就是需要注意几点:1)模型导入的时候,是需要导入模型的网络结构和模型的参数,有的pytorch模型只保存了模型参数,还需要导入模型的网络结构;2)pytorch转为onnx的时候需要输入onnx模型的输入尺寸,有的 ...

Convert your PyTorch training model to ONNX Microsoft …

WebFeb 13, 2024 · torch::Tensor dummy_input = torch::randn ( {1, 3, 224, 224}); dummy_input.to (torch::kCUDA); auto traced_script_module = torch::jit::trace (model, dummy_input); traced_script_module.save ("traced_model.pt"); and then import it into a simple PyTorch script to convert to ONNX: Webscript. Scripting a function or nn.Module will inspect the source code, compile it as TorchScript code using the TorchScript compiler, and return a ScriptModule or ScriptFunction.. trace. Trace a function and return an executable or ScriptFunction that will be optimized using just-in-time compilation.. script_if_tracing. Compiles fn when it is first … mark andy supplies https://ilikehair.net

TorchScript + ONNX - PyTorch Forums

WebUnlike PyTorch’s Just-In-Time (JIT) compiler, Torch-TensorRT is an Ahead-of-Time (AOT) compiler, meaning that before you deploy your TorchScript code, you go through an explicit compile step to convert a standard TorchScript program into an module targeting a TensorRT engine. Torch-TensorRT operates as a PyTorch extention and compiles … WebMar 15, 2024 · Sometimes certain layers are not yet supported by pytorch-onnx conversion. Also, make sure your your model and weights are on the same device by … WebMay 5, 2024 · convert yolov5 model to ONNX and run on c++ interface Ask Question Asked 1 year, 10 months ago Modified 17 days ago Viewed 7k times 2 I have yolo model as yolov5s.yaml and i have saved my weights file as best.pt . Now want to convert yolo model to ONNX and run on c++ interface . nausea fainting

Exporting transformers models — transformers 3.3.0 documentation - H…

Category:(optional) Exporting a Model from PyTorch to ONNX and …

Tags:Convert torchscript to onnx

Convert torchscript to onnx

海思开发:mobilefacenet 模型: pytorch -> onnx -> caffe -> …

WebDec 8, 2024 · Back when PyTorch 1.0 was announced, there was this little mention of @script annotations and ONNX. I know ONNX has been using this form of tracing prior … WebNov 10, 2024 · Step 1: Create TorchScript module by using either torch.jit.trace or/and torch.jit.script on your PyTorch model Step 2: Transfer these modules to the production environment using torch.jit.save/torch.jit.load. In this format, they can be run anywhere from servers to edge devices

Convert torchscript to onnx

Did you know?

WebApr 5, 2024 · Most of the NeMo models can be exported to ONNX or TorchScript to be deployed for inference in optimized execution environments, such as Riva or Triton … Web) assert check, "Simplified ONNX model could not be validated" import os os. remove (f) 1. onnx 转换问题. 由于 pytorch 有 onnx 导出接口,所以导出 onnx 会以为很轻松,谁知道每次简化完,会有些奇怪的 op ,与朋友交流,经其提醒才发现原来 mobilefacenet 网络输出前做了个 L2范数归一化。

Webfacebook/nllb-200-3.3B向AWS神经元的转换. 我正在尝试将 new translation model developed by Facebook (Meta) ,不留下任何语言,转换为AWS的神经元模型,该模型可以与使用Inferentia芯片的AWS SageMaker推理一起使用。. 但是,我不知道如何在没有错误的情况下跟踪模型。. WebInference with TorchScript . If you are running in an environment that is more constrained where you cannot install PyTorch or other Python libraries, you have the option of performing inference with PyTorch models that have been converted to TorchScript. ... The first step is to export your PyTorch model to ONNX format using the PyTorch ONNX ...

WebIt replaces parts of the model with Caffe2 operators, and then export the model into Caffe2, TorchScript or ONNX format. The converted model is able to run in either Python or C++ without detectron2/torchvision dependency, on CPU or GPUs. It has a runtime optimized for CPU & mobile inference, but not optimized for GPU inference. WebOct 8, 2024 · 🐛 Bug TorchScript -> ONNX conversion of a simple module fails If one doesn’t jit-compile the model, everything works. To Reproduce from tempfile import …

WebExporting a PyTorch Model to ONNX Format ¶. PyTorch models are defined in Python. To export them, use the torch.onnx.export () method. The code to evaluate or test the model is usually provided with its code and can be used for its initialization and export. The export to ONNX is crucial for this process, but it is covered by PyTorch framework ...

WebJul 21, 2024 · I used torch.onnx.export () to convert my torchscript to onnx. But the result files can have so many look like weight / bias files: ptrblck July 21, 2024, 10:38pm #2 Could you post the code which is creating these files, please? jing_xu (jing … nausea fainting headacheWebApr 19, 2024 · ONNX format models can painlessly be exported from PyTorch, and experiments have shown ONNX Runtime to be outperforming TorchScript. For all those … mark and ziggy wilfWebFor example, a model trained in PyTorch can be exported to ONNX format and then imported in TensorFlow (and vice versa). 🤗 Transformers provides a transformers.onnx package that enables you to convert model checkpoints to an ONNX graph by leveraging configuration objects. These configuration objects come ready made for a number of … mark andy xp5000WebFeb 25, 2024 · Conversion of Torchvision (v0.11) Int8 Quantized models to onnx produces the following error. AttributeError: 'torch.dtype' object has no attribute 'detach' Is it not supported yet? we are not working on onnx support, please contact PoC from MS for help. cc @supriyar do you know the PoC from MS for onnx? mark a nelson artistWebTo use converter in your project: Import converter: import model_converter. Create an instance of a convertor: my_converter = model_converter. Converter ( save_dir= nausea expected findingsWebJun 22, 2024 · Convert the PyTorch model to ONNX format To convert the resulting model you need just one instruction torch.onnx.export, which required the following arguments: the pre-trained model itself, tensor with the same size as input data, name of ONNX file, input and output names. mark andy spare partsWebHere is a more involved tutorial on exporting a model and running it with ONNX Runtime.. Tracing vs Scripting ¶. Internally, torch.onnx.export() requires a torch.jit.ScriptModule … nausea every time i eat no matter what i eat